ShibataFender Team supplies cone fender systems for expansion in Texas Freeport

Undergoing expansion works are taking place at Freeport in Texas, US that will allow the port to handle larger vessels.

In this phase of the project, berth seven of the Velasco Terminal is being refurbished to make it the deepest container terminal in the Gulf of Texas and a new berth is being built, number eight, to gain additional terminal length to accommodate vessels from Panamax to Post-Panamax class.

Working in cooperation with McCarthy Building Companies and the engineering company Moffatt and Nichol, ShibataFender Team designed and manufactured 43 sets of SPC Cone Fenders Systems, each consisting of one Cone Fender (SPC 1400 G2.4) and a closed box panel (2300×5450 mm) with UHMW-PE pads.

Of these 43 systems, 27 were installed at berth eight and the other 16 at berth number seven. The order scope also included 29 T Head Bollards (150 t).
